为什么我的小程序不出字

抖音小程序 2024-01-10 11:01:34 32
为什么我的小程序不出字?

在开发小程序时,可能会遇到各种问题,其中之一就是文字无法正常显示。为了解决这个问题,我们需要分析可能的原因并采取相应的解决办法。

原因一:文本内容格式问题

1. 检查文本是否包含特殊格式或符号,例如空格、换行符、制表符等。这些格式可能会导致文本显示异常。

2. 确保文本字体、字号和颜色设置正确。在小程序中,可以通过 wx:style 标签设置字体、字号和颜色,例如:


wx:style

="{  fontSize:  14px,  color:  #333  }"
原因二:容器宽度不足

1. 检查包含文本的容器(如 view scroll-view )的宽度是否足够。如果宽度不足,文本可能会被截断或显示不全。

2. 使用 flex 布局设置容器宽度,以确保文本有足够的空间显示。例如:

为什么我的小程序不出字


flex

:
  
1
原因三:文本超链接问题

1. 检查文本是否包含超链接,并确保超链接功能正常。如果超链接存在问题,文本可能会显示异常。

2. 使用 wx:link 标签设置超链接,例如:


wx:link

="https://www.example.com"
原因四:组件加载问题

1. 确保所有需要的组件都已正确加载。如果在加载过程中出现错误,可能会导致文本显示异常。

2. 使用 wx:if 标签检查组件是否加载完成,例如:


wx:if

(

"{{loaded}}"

)
   
wx:text

(

"组件加载完成,显示文本"

)

wx:else
   
wx:text

(

"组件加载中,暂无文本"

)

wx:endif
总结

遇到小程序不出字的问题时,可以从文本内容格式、容器宽度、超链接和组件加载等方面进行排查。找到问题所在,并进行相应的优化和调整,即可解决文字显示异常的问题。

The End